Abstract

Farmers still do not really understand how to diagnose problems in plants, one example is strawberry farmers. This is proven by several farmers and strawberry plant cultivators, not all of whom can understand the disease where there are various types of diseases that can attack strawberry plants with almost the same symptoms , and if a farmer or cultivator is wrong in handling the type of strawberry plant disease, it is not impossible that it will cause the strawberry plant to die. Strawberry farmers need a tool to diagnose strawberry plant diseases so that they can find out the condition of the strawberry plants. Therefore, an expert system was created to diagnose diseases in strawberry plants and find solutions to deal with the damage that occurs. The system built for diagnosing diseases in strawberry plants uses the Forward Chaining method. Forward chaining is a forward tracking that starts from a set of facts by looking for rules that match the existing hypothesis towards a conclusion. In its implementation, this system has met these objectives by using a database and rule base. The system draws conclusions based on existing facts using the forward chaining method, the search starts from the facts from which new conclusions are obtained, the existing rules are traced one by one until the search is stopped because the last condition has been met.

Abstract

The increasingly rapid advancement of technology has an indirect impact on humans. Computers are one of the results of technological advances that can help humans improve the quality and quantity of work. By using computers as one of the tools in presenting data information, especially data processing supported by PHP and MySQL applications, it can support the speed of data processing as efficiently as possible. This study uses the Importance Performance Analysis (IPA) Method and the Customer Satisfaction Index (CSI) Method. The IPA method is a method used to map the relationship between interests and performance of each attribute to meet consumer satisfaction by providing a Likert scale. While the CSI method is a method used to determine the level of consumer satisfaction as a whole by looking at the level of satisfaction of product and service attributes. Based on the combination of the IPA and CSI methods carried out directly in the field using interview techniques, as well as by studying books related to the problems discussed, it is expected that the new system that will be implemented can improve the quality of information so that it can be useful for the relevant agencies. The results of this study are based on the consumer satisfaction index of 82.24% , so that by applying these two methods, it can find consumer satisfaction in increasing curtain sales.
